Hackathon - HACK4FOOD

sp4

A two-day Hackathon – HACK4FOOD was organized in collaboration with Startup Odisha at Sri Sri University on 29-30 March, 2019. 57 aspiring and budding entrepreneurs from OUAT, Utkal University, GEC, Birla Global University, SOA University, KIIT University, etc. participated in the Hackathon.

The theme for the Hackathon was the technologies in Agri and Food Processing sector. Twelve prototypes were developed by the participants in the areas of IOT based apiculture, soil moisture management app, app for market linkage for farmers, horticulture, aquaculture, fertilizer management, micro irrigation, etc.

Startup Forerunner

Startup Forerunner was the weeklong event organized from 9-14th Sept. 2019 at Sri Sri University. This platform united different stakeholders of the startup ecosystem such as; entrepreneurs, mentors, successful startup founders, alumni entrepreneurs, financial experts, industry experts and policy makers. 82 aspiring and budding entrepreneurs from various institutes of Odisha participated in the event. 17 mentors were invited to mentor the entrepreneurs on various areas such as; idea generation and idea validation, prototype development, IPR, value proposition, how to register the legal entity, Govt. initiatives for startup support, etc. Two prospective investors were also invited to this programme and they shared their rich experience on investor readiness. This event assisted the aspiring and budding entrepreneurs to shape their ideas and launching their ventures.

Workshop on How to Identify Cofounders

A right founding team is very crucial for success of any startup and most of the startup founders face problem in identifying their cofounders. Many startups have failed due to lack of cohesion and proper understanding between co-founders. To overcome this challenge, Sri Sri University organized a workshop on “How to identify your Cofounders” on 18th January, 2020, where students from National Law University, KIIT University, DRIEMS, IMI Bhubaneswar participated in the workshop. Students were trained on different entrepreneurship styles and also trained on how to identify cofounders based on certain psychological tests during the workshop. The session was conducted by Mr. Deepak Motwani, ex-regional manager, National Entrepreneurship Network.

Prototype Development Workshop

Most of the startups take the risk of directly developing the product, without developing a prototype or minimum viable product. As the products are developed without validated by customers, many times it’s not accepted in the market. Understanding this gap, Sri Sri University organized a workshop on how to develop prototype on 8th Feb. 2020. The session was conducted by Mr. Barada P. Panigrahy. He trained the participants on various types of prototypes such as paper, digital and throwaway prototype. At the end of the workshop, the participants developed prototype for their business ideas.
